Benzylic Functionalization of Arene(tricarbonyl)chromium Complexes
Brocard, Jacques,Lebibi, Jacques,Couturier, Daniel
, p. 1264 - 1265 (2007/10/02)
The complexation of a Cr(CO)3 unit to an aromatic hydrocarbon enhances the benzylic position towards attack by base and the resulting carbanion reacts with carbonyl compounds to produce a complexed alcohol; this reaction may be used to functionalize the benzylic position of an aromatic hydrocarbon.
